    The official way to download the firmware is from the Cisco Software Download Center. However, Cisco requires an active service contract for the specific hardware. For older devices like the 1600 series, which may have reached end-of-life (EoL), obtaining a valid support contract to unlock the download may be expensive or impossible.

    If the AP is configured but the web interface remains unavailable, verify the BVI interface has been assigned an IP address and that the HTTP server is enabled on the AP CLI ( ip http server ). Additionally, check that the client computer is on the same subnet and that no firewall policies block HTTP traffic to the AP.

    This denotes that the image is a Wireless Autonomous image. This is the magic part of the file—it contains all the web-based GUI and CLI code necessary for the access point to operate as a standalone device without needing a hardware or software-based Cisco Wireless LAN Controller.
